View from the dining room window.

View from the dining room window.
Today was a relief in that the recent calima (Saharan dust cloud), and the smoke from the wild-fires in Portugal and Western Spain finally cleared, leaving a lovely view for the first time in about a week!
Perhaps better on full screen.
Added extra little titbit (I'm not American so it's titbit OK?); bottom left hand corner of the shot is the top of a pot of basil. Usually they last 1 to 2 weeks and then they expire and you buy another on your next shop (very cheap). But this hardy little bugger has been happily thriving for a couple of months now - almost to the point when I'll have to think up a name for it as it has almost become part of the family!
